FAQs for finding a math tutor near you in Richmond, VA
How much does it cost to hire a math tutor near me in Richmond, VA?
How much it costs to hire a math tutor near you depends on a handful of different factors including the subject your child needs help with, the area you live in, the age of your child, and the experience of the math tutor. With that in mind, the average hourly rate on Care.com for hiring math tutors near you is Richmond, VA is $23.43.
